Exclusion Techniques to Keep Crickets Out of Buildings
Exclusion methods focus on preventing crickets from entering homes and other structures. The work involves sealing cracks around foundations and doors and installing door sweeps and weather stripping to close gaps that crickets can exploit. It also includes installing screens on windows vents and other openings and ensuring fine mesh size to deter even smaller crickets.
Lighting and Moisture Management at Night
Crickets are attracted to warm light sources during night hours and prefer damp environments. Reducing outdoor lighting and using lights with lower attractive wavelengths can significantly reduce cricket activity near human dwellings. In addition improving drainage redirecting irrigation away from foundations and scheduling watering for mornings reduces lingering moisture that crickets detect.
Landscape Design and Plant Choices to Discourage Crickets
Landscape design can transform a yard into an environment that is less inviting to crickets. Choose ground covers that do not provide continuous shelter and prune dense shrubs away from building walls to improve air flow and visibility. Maintain mulch at shallow depths remove dense piles of debris and avoid creating dark moist pockets that crickets find appealing.

Non chemical Deterrence Checklist
-
Remove leaf litter and wood piles that provide shelter for crickets.
-
Seal cracks and gaps around doors and windows.
-
Install door sweeps and weather stripping on all entry points.
-
Fit window screens on vents and seal gaps around the foundation with fine mesh.
-
Manage lawn and garden debris by removing tall grasses and piles of compost near the home.
-
Improve drainage and avoid overwatering to keep soil dry.
-
Place diatomaceous earth around foundation or under entry mats to deter crickets.
-
Use amber lighting around the exterior to reduce insect attraction.
-
Encourage habitat features for natural predators such as birds and lizards to supplement cricket control.

Water Management in Different Climates
Water management conditions differ with climate and influence habitat suitability for crickets. In arid zones crickets are less common but irrigation can create temporary damp zones that attract them. In humid subtropical regions careful irrigation practices together with proper drainage can greatly reduce moisture pockets that invite crickets.
